The Regulatory Framework: Italy and the EFSA
When discussing dietary supplements-- understood in Italian as integratori alimentari-- it is essential to comprehend the governing bodies. Italy's Ministry of Health (Ministero della Salute) works in tandem with the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A) to regulate what can be sold on the marketplace.
Unlike some countries where supplements are largely uncontrolled until an issue emerges, Italy enforces rigorous notice procedures. Makers should register their products with the Ministry of Health before they can be offered to customers. This ensures that the components comply with EU safety limitations and do not consist of prohibited compounds or harmful pharmaceutical adulterants.
Common Categories of Weight Loss Supplements
Weight-loss supplements typically fall into a couple of unique categories based on their mechanism of action. In Italy, customers generally search for items that assist metabolism, block nutrient absorption, or reduce appetite naturally.
1. Thermogenics and Metabolism Boosters
These supplements intend to increase the body's basal metabolic rate, encouraging the burning of calories.
2. Appetite Suppressants and Satiety Promoters
These products are created to assist minimize total calorie intake by promoting a sensation of fullness.
3. Carb and Fat Blockers
These supplements declare to inhibit the enzymes accountable for breaking down carbohydrates or fats, avoiding them from being fully taken in by the body.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Are weight loss supplements FDA-approved in Italy?
No. The FDA (Food and Drug Administration) is a United States agency. In Italy, supplements are controlled by the Italian Ministry of Health and must abide by European Union food security laws and EFSA guidelines.
Can I buy prescription weight loss pills non-prescription in Italy?
No. Prescription weight reduction medications need a physician's prescription and can just be dispensed by certified pharmacies. Over the counter weight loss supplements do not contain pharmaceutical-grade weight-loss drugs.
Are natural supplements totally safe?
Not always. Just due to the fact that a product is "natural" does not suggest it is complimentary of adverse effects. For instance, high doses of stimulants like bitter orange or caffeine can elevate heart rate and blood pressure, especially in delicate people.
Do weight loss supplements work without diet and exercise?
Usually, no. Supplements might offer a marginal metabolic boost or help manage hunger, but they can not bypass a caloric surplus triggered by bad diet and a sedentary way of life.
